    Abstract : Chronic wounds are an emerging healthcare issue and current methods of healing chronic wounds address bacteria but are ineffective against resistant bacteria and the biofilm formation commonly observed in these wounds. Antimicrobial peptides (AMPs) derived from the endogenous wound healing system have been shown to combat bacterial infections, exhibit immunomodulatory effects, as well as improving wound healing.     Abstract : Na+,K+-ATPase (NKA) is a membrane protein which assists in maintaining the electrochemical potential across the cell membrane. It has been suggested that the oligomerization of NKA may play a role in intracellular regulation of NKA activity. READ MORE

    Abstract : The nucleotide-binding oligomerization domain–like receptor family pyrin domain containing 3 (NLRP3) inflammasome is a group of multi-protein complex that mediates immune responses through the production of biologically active IL-1β and IL-18. Dysregulation of NLRP3 inflammasome has been linked to various diseases associated with infection, inflammation, and cancer. READ MORE
